Children's muscles must grow substantially to propel the growing body. But do all muscles grow at the same rate? We answered this question using data from >200 children (5-15 years) and infants. The answer? No! doi.org/10.1111/joa.13… Journal of Anatomy NeuRA (Neuroscience Research Australia) NeuRA Imaging

Ethanol reduces brain tissue electrical conductivity in social drinkers. Related to brain activity? What else can we show with MREPT? Stay tuned! Doi.org/10.1002/jmri.2… Great work by Jun Cao, Liz Summerell et al. NeuRA Imaging Australian National Imaging Facility
